Electrical Engineering – A Distinguished Field of Engineering 

electrical engineering

The electrical engineering department's role is to be mainly responsible for evaluating and assessing the needs of a development.  The electrical engineer must make sure codes are complied with and ensure the future safety of a structure. An electrician in Los Angeles would be very familiar with such codes.  In addition, an electrical engineer must coordinate and design electrical systems for the project at hand. Another important function would be to select electrical wiring that is the proper fit for each project.  This type of engineering can include projects with brand new buildings, additions to existing buildings, and the remodeling of older structures. This field of work can also encompass individuals that work at power plants, or even in labs where testing and researching of electrical issues occur. 

It is very important that an electrical engineer meet the needs of a particular structure using proper capacities for safety reasons.  This becomes a very important factor in building a new structure from homes to coliseums and all that falls between.  The field of electrical engineering designs and coordinates the wiring of a new building. This would include deciding what materials and how much of the materials will be needed.  In a project of this nature the engineer would have to work closely with the architect for the building progress to move along on a timely basis.   

When an existing structure is being added on to an electrical engineer must calculate the demand of the electricity necessary for the addition that is about to occur. Electrical engineering is a specific field of broader category of engineering.  It requires a four year degree from a credited institution. Someone that excels in this field has usually excelled in various math and science courses.  In addition, many positions may require these engineers to spend some time with clients, other engineers and architects so being able to relate with others is certainly a plus.
